Council approves no‑parking rule to protect Freedom Plaza farmers market, subject to city attorney resolution

Twentynine Palms City Council · December 10, 2025
AI-Generated Content: All content on this page was generated by AI to highlight key points from the meeting. For complete details and context, we recommend watching the full video. so we can fix them.

Summary

To prevent overnight vehicles from occupying vendor spaces, the council approved a targeted no‑parking/towing approach for the Freedom Plaza red‑paver area (proposed hours 4 a.m. to 3 p.m. Saturdays), subject to the city attorney finalizing a resolution; temporary signs may be used until permanent signage is posted.

The Twentynine Palms City Council approved a staff proposal to establish enforceable no‑parking/towing for the Freedom Plaza area on Saturdays to protect the long‑running farmers market.
